![]() ![]() A ring by designer Valentin Magro featuring a cushion-cut, 1.01-carat, fancy-intense-green diamond flanked by two cushion-cut, orange-yellow diamonds brought in $69,850. ![]() Three other rings offered without reserve also disappointed. ![]() The ring, which also included a combined 1.31 carats of white diamonds and pinks totaling 1.01 carats, had no minimum price at the March 8 Important Jewels auction, Sotheby’s said Thursday. The crossover design set with a fancy-deep-greyish-yellowish-green diamond of 1.78 carats and a fancy-green diamond weighing 1.64 carats went for $82,550, missing its $350,000 to $550,000 presale estimate. A pink and green diamond ring failed to reach even a quarter of its low estimate after being offered without reserve at the most recent Sotheby’s sale in New York. ![]()
